Concerta (time release formulation of Ritalin) is very consistant and mild. Also, you doctor will probably only prescribe one month's worth at a time.

It is not the type of medication that will give you a real strong "buzz". I used to "self-medicate" also. But I have had no problem sticking to my Concerta prescribed dosage. It just feels like it makes me alert and clears my head.

Straterra is a very strange acting drug. And it may be too new to determine if it really is not addictive anyway. It was developed originally as an anti-depressant.
